Spinach Ricotta Cannelloni

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ups fresh spinach, chopped
  • 1 cup whole milk ricotta cheese
  • 8 lasagna sheets
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cups marinara sauce
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 large egg
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Sauté minced garlic in olive oil until fragrant. Add spinach and cook until wilted.
  3. In a bowl, combine sautéed spinach, ricotta, half of the Parmesan, egg, salt, and pepper until creamy.
  4. Fill each lasagna sheet with about 2 tablespoons of filling and roll tightly.
  5. Spread marinara sauce on the bottom of a baking dish and place filled cannelloni seam-side down.
  6. Top with more marinara sauce and remaining Parmesan cheese.
  7. Bake for 30-35 minutes until bubbly and golden.
